As a security reviewer, note that limit overrides require dual approval and are logged immutably to the audit stream. Emergency bypass of rate limiting is possible only through the recovery console, which requires re-authentication of the reviewing engineer's service identity. If that identity is locked out during an incident, the recovery flow prompts for the team passphrase, which is recorded directly below.

vault phrase of tajeg-tageg = pelix-druix-holius-briael-zorwyn-frawyn-fraox-norok-drueth-aldiel

Ticket MNK-4471: Mobile deep-link routing broken after the Lanternfox 3.2 release. Links using the shortcart scheme open the app but land on the home screen instead of the product page. Root cause appears to be the route table regenerated without the legacy path aliases. Fix is staged on the hotfix branch and passes the routing test suite. On-call should deploy once sign-off is recorded. Per the Brightquill release policy, this change requires approval from the routing owner.

named custodian: Oliath Ralax

Known issue: Relaymesh clients can enter a reconnect loop after a gateway restart, retrying every 200ms without backoff. Symptom is a spike in connection churn on the dashboard and customers reporting dropped live sessions. Workaround: cycle the affected gateway node, which forces clients onto the patched handshake path. Full diagnosis steps and the patch rollout status are tracked here:

runbook for badug-kadup: https://confluence.zemvarlabs.internal/projects/browse/display/projects/bd1b

Facilities Ticket — Cleaning Crew Access, Brindle Annex

For new starters handling evening lock-up: the Sorano Cleaning crew arrives nightly at 21:30 via the annex side door. Check their rota sheet, note arrival in the log, and ensure the storeroom is relocked afterward. To let them through the side door, enter the access code below.

badge for yaweg-hafog: bdg-GX-6